I’m talking about the harsh reality is that the typical Western diet, and even many so-called “healthy” diet plans, contain far too many inflammation-promoting Omega-6 fatty acids and not nearly enough anti-inflammatory Omega-3 fatty acids.

You see, the ideal dietary ratio of Omega-6 to Omega-3 fatty acids is 1:1 or an equal intake of omega-3s compared to Omega-6s.

Unfortunately, due to an overconsumption of processed vegetable oils (found in baked goods, packaged foods, and cooking oils), non-organic meats, eggs, and dairy products, farmed fish, fried foods, high-heat processed nuts and seeds, and heavily refined grain products—all of which are loaded with Omega-6 fatty acids—the Omega-6 to Omega-3 ratio of the typical Australian diet is an extremely unbalanced 25:1…

The result?  Toxic Inflammation Overload that spreads throughout your body, destroys your health, and makes it nearly impossible for you to realize the weight loss goals that you are working so hard to achieve.

You see, ingestion of Omega-6 fatty acids stimulates the release of pro-inflammatory molecules called eicosanoids. When these inflammatory molecules are continually present due to daily excessive Omega-6 intake, they essentially act as a persistent slow-burning fire that wreaks havoc on your insides and causes damage to the healthy tissues of your body—damage to cardiac tissue and blood vessels (causing your arterial walls to thicken and your blood passageways to narrow), joint tissue, gut lining, endocrine glands, skin, and even brain tissue.

And if this weren’t enough, too much Omega-6 in your diet also suppresses your immune system, making you much more susceptible to illness and disease.
